aboutsummaryrefslogtreecommitdiff
path: root/ShiftOS.Frontend/Resources
diff options
context:
space:
mode:
authorwilliam341 <[email protected]>2017-07-28 14:26:14 -0700
committerwilliam341 <[email protected]>2017-07-28 14:26:27 -0700
commita9779111b59f259d834b431a53b11de868e7b6a3 (patch)
treebfa0ed1fd2a7c288ce33665024cd9f8e4943fdb6 /ShiftOS.Frontend/Resources
parent5c6d90ce3de81174bd254b0291ab6a598d3d2898 (diff)
downloadshiftos_thereturn-a9779111b59f259d834b431a53b11de868e7b6a3.tar.gz
shiftos_thereturn-a9779111b59f259d834b431a53b11de868e7b6a3.tar.bz2
shiftos_thereturn-a9779111b59f259d834b431a53b11de868e7b6a3.zip
partially implemented loot system
Diffstat (limited to 'ShiftOS.Frontend/Resources')
-rw-r--r--ShiftOS.Frontend/Resources/Exploits.txt3
-rw-r--r--ShiftOS.Frontend/Resources/LootInfo.txt21
-rw-r--r--ShiftOS.Frontend/Resources/Payloads.txt5
-rw-r--r--ShiftOS.Frontend/Resources/Shiftorium.txt15
4 files changed, 38 insertions, 6 deletions
diff --git a/ShiftOS.Frontend/Resources/Exploits.txt b/ShiftOS.Frontend/Resources/Exploits.txt
index 4ad6caf..a3fa2fc 100644
--- a/ShiftOS.Frontend/Resources/Exploits.txt
+++ b/ShiftOS.Frontend/Resources/Exploits.txt
@@ -8,11 +8,12 @@
{
FriendlyName: "FTP Exploit",
ExploitName: "ftpwn",
- EffectiveAgainstPort: "FileServer",
+ EffectiveAgainstPort: "FileServer"
},
{
FriendlyName: "SSH Exploit",
ExploitName: "sshardline",
EffectiveAgainstPort: "SSHServer",
+ Dependencies: "sploitset_sshardline"
}
] \ No newline at end of file
diff --git a/ShiftOS.Frontend/Resources/LootInfo.txt b/ShiftOS.Frontend/Resources/LootInfo.txt
index 361bab9..ff2784d 100644
--- a/ShiftOS.Frontend/Resources/LootInfo.txt
+++ b/ShiftOS.Frontend/Resources/LootInfo.txt
@@ -1,3 +1,20 @@
-//Loot information table
+/* ShiftOS Loot data file
+ *
+ * This file contains information about all loot in the game's campaign.
+ *
+ */
-[] \ No newline at end of file
+[
+ {
+ FriendlyName: "Force Heartbeat",
+ LootName: "sploitset_keepalive",
+ Rarity: 1,
+ PointTo: "sploitset_keepalive",
+ },
+ {
+ FriendlyName: "SSHardline",
+ LootName: "sploitset_sshardline",
+ Rarity: 1,
+ PointTo: "sploitset_sshardline",
+ }
+] \ No newline at end of file
diff --git a/ShiftOS.Frontend/Resources/Payloads.txt b/ShiftOS.Frontend/Resources/Payloads.txt
index 37eace6..d203158 100644
--- a/ShiftOS.Frontend/Resources/Payloads.txt
+++ b/ShiftOS.Frontend/Resources/Payloads.txt
@@ -9,13 +9,14 @@
FriendlyName: "FTP Payload",
PayloadName: "ftpull",
EffectiveAgainstFirewall: 1,
- EffectiveAgainst: "FileServer",
+ EffectiveAgainst: "FileServer"
},
{
- FriendlyName: "Ping Spam",
+ FriendlyName: "Force Heartbeat",
PayloadName: "keepalive",
EffectiveAgainstFirewall: 1,
EffectiveAgainst: "SSHServer",
Function: 1,
+ Dependencies: "sploitset_keepalive"
}
] \ No newline at end of file
diff --git a/ShiftOS.Frontend/Resources/Shiftorium.txt b/ShiftOS.Frontend/Resources/Shiftorium.txt
index 0637a08..55368b3 100644
--- a/ShiftOS.Frontend/Resources/Shiftorium.txt
+++ b/ShiftOS.Frontend/Resources/Shiftorium.txt
@@ -1 +1,14 @@
-[] \ No newline at end of file
+[
+ }
+ Name: "sploitset_keepalive",
+ Cost: 1000000000,
+ Description: "lolyouarentsupposedtobeabletobuythis",
+ Dependencies: "thisupgradeshouldneverexistever;sploitset_sshardline",
+ },
+ }
+ Name: "sploitset_sshardline",
+ Cost: 1000000000,
+ Description: "lolyouarentsupposedtobeabletobuythis",
+ Dependencies: "thisupgradeshouldneverexistever",
+ }
+] \ No newline at end of file